Why leak prevention matters on the Maxus Lite
Consistent filling torque and proper sealing rings remove most transit leaks.
Freight consolidation changes the answer to leak prevention at container scale, which is why small and large buyers reach different conclusions.
Pressure changes during air freight are a common cause of minor seepage.

Frequently asked questions
How can leakage in Maxus Lite shipments be reduced?
Use sealed inner trays, keep cartons upright and allow a settling period before retail display.
